Forecast: Self-Employed People in Advertising and Market Research Sector in Finland

In 2023, the self-employed population in Finland's advertising and market research sector stood at 3.8 thousand persons. From 2013 to 2023, the sector experienced fluctuations, with periods of growth interspersed with declines. The year-on-year variation from 2023 to 2022 indicates stabilization with 0% change over the past year. However, the CAGR over the last five years reveals stagnant growth at 0%. Forecast data from 2024 to 2028 suggests a conservative recovery with an average annual growth rate (CAGR) of 0.51%, predicting the self-employed population to reach 4.0 thousand persons by 2028.

Future trends to watch for include the potential impact of digital transformation, increased demand for data analytics skills, and the continued rise of freelancing platforms which could drive more individuals towards self-employment within the advertising and market research industry.
